The HP 320K Keyboard is a sleek, ergonomic wired keyboard designed for comfort and efficiency. Compatible with PCs via USB, it offers a lightweight build and compact dimensions, making it an ideal choice for professionals seeking a reliable typing solution.
Brand | HP |
Series | 320K Keyboard |
Item model number | 320K |
Hardware Platform | Compatible with PCs with available USB port. |
Operating System | Windows 10 |
Item Weight | 1.26 pounds |
Product Dimensions | 17.5 x 5.8 x 1 inches |
Item Dimensions LxWxH | 17.5 x 5.8 x 1 inches |
Color | Information Not Available |
Power Source | USB Power, Wired |
Manufacturer | HP Inc. |
ASIN | B08PVYS2YV |
Date First Available | December 7, 2020 |

D**L
great compact keyboard
Full size but a smaller foot print than usual keyboards. Good key function and layout. Quality build. Only negative is that keys are a tad closer together which takes getting used to if you have arthritic hands, but if you slow down, works fine. Great for tight spaces.
K**Z
HP hasn't failed me yet!
Great, cheap, slimish keyboard. If you're used to the low travel scissor laptop keyboards this is going to take getting used to though. However if you worked on mechanical block button keyboards then this will be WAY easier to type on.Has a ridiculously long USB cable too :D
